Zusammenfassung:[Display omitted] •Soil clay content is a primary soil component influencing wind erosion•This study assessed the effect of clay amendment on threshold friction velocity (u*t)•Clay amendment didn’t directly impact u*t, but did impact crust, aggregate properties•Threshold friction velocities were sensitive to lower clay amendments (
